After Bunny Blackburn snapped up her favorite 1926 Georgian Revival house from her childhood, she turned to friend and Nashville designer Sarah Bartholomew for design help. To reflect her friend's personality, Bartholomew artfully mixed feminine florals with graphic patterns. Let's check it out, shall we?
